PART 7WINDING UP BY THE COURT

CHAPTER 11Calls on contributories

Court order to enforce payment of call by a contributory7.91

1

The court may make an order to enforce payment of the amount due from a contributory.

2

The order must have the title “Order for payment of call due from contributory” and must contain—

a

the name of the court (and hearing centre if applicable) in which the order is made;

b

identification and contact details for the liquidator who made the application;

c

the name and title of the judge making the order;

d

identification details for the company;

e

the name and postal address of the contributory who is the subject of the order;

f

the amount per share of the call;

g

an order that the contributory pay the liquidator the sum stated in the order in respect of the call on or before the date stated in the order or within four business days after service of the order whichever is the later;

h

an order that the contributory pay the liquidator interest at the rate stated in the order for the period commencing from the date specified in the order to the date of payment;

i

an order that the contributory pay the liquidator a stated sum in respect of the liquidator’s costs of the application within the same period as the amount of the call must be paid;

j

a warning to the contributory that if the required sums are not paid within the time specified in the order further steps will be taken to compel the contributory to comply with the order; and

k

the date of the order.
